Runbook fragment — Velmora render cluster. If template rendering latency exceeds 400ms p95, the Cassit account used by the render workers has likely been locked by the auth sweeper. Recover the account via the Fenwright ops portal, restart the template compiler pods, and confirm cache warmup. For eng sync awareness: the portal's recovery flow requires the passphrase noted below.

unlock words, kawig-bawef: belax-sorir-druax-ulaiel-wenael-belael

Hey Priya — handing off the Fennelworks webhook retry changes before the release. We moved from fixed 30s retries to exponential backoff with jitter, capped at six attempts. Dead-lettering kicks in after that, so no more silent drops. Flagging for the release manager: nothing else changed. Current settings are as follows:

settings of tagef-bawif:
DRUIX_HOST=druix.zemvarlabs.internal
DRUIX_PORT=8000

Subject: Uniform delivery – Ashgrove Depot opening

Dispatch desk,

Please schedule the uniform consignment for the new Ashgrove Depot to arrive Thursday morning. Forty sets, boxed by size, shipped from the Renwick supply room. The depot coordinator will verify counts against the packing list on arrival. Ensure the assigned courier carries out the hand-over instruction provided below.

handover note for yagef-bagep: the drudor pelius courier leaves the kasdor zorvan norir ledger at gate 8016 under passcode 755406

**Vendor note: Inkmill markdown pipeline**

Rendering for Parchway docs is outsourced to Inkmill under an annual contract, renewing each March. They handle sanitization and PDF export; we own the upload queue. SLA: 4-hour response on rendering failures. Escalate only after two failed retries. Their support desk is reachable at the address below.

billing contact of hahaf-baguf = zorael.tammir.jorius@sivrelhq.internal